FIU Chief Pilot/ Training Captain - 2009/12/08 17:55 Introduction
The Flight Inspection Unit (FIU) of the SACAA operates a Cessna Citation C550 SII (ZA-CAR) to perform the in-flight inspection of aviation navigational aids within the RSA and in some SADC states.

The FIU requires a suitable candidate for the role of FIU Chief Pilot for the FIU's Part 121 AOC operation. It is envisaged that the FIU Pilot will be a full time position. Candidates are welcome to apply for the above role after which a selection of qualified individual will be made by the SACAA from the applicants.

Minimum Qualifications
* Current South African ATP licence with minimum Grade II Instructor Rating.
* Minimum of 3500 hours total time, 750 hours command on turbine multi-engine aircraft with 200 hours on type.
* Two years managerial experience would be desirable.
